Summary:
The Operations Manager manages Fleet Managers and all day-to-day activities within operations. They must be able to make good judgments without the benefit of others immediate counsel and must be exceptional documenters. They must be able to perform their duties autonomously.
Additional Responsibilities- Operations Manager
- Directly supports and manages Fleet Managers and serves as coverage when needed.
- Ensures that each driver has an adequate understanding of all details of customer and company expectation on each load at the point of dispatch.
- Collaborate with department manager to develop performance, execution, and growth plans
- Analyze the performance of the department, make recommendations to improve, and implement said improvements
- Act as responsible individual for department with regards to service & safety performance
- Implement strategy to improve/build upon both regional and OTR team network strategies
- Assist with scrubbing through driver lists.
- Ensure computer work is accurate, hold team accountable for inaccurate computer work
- Set up travel for drivers as needed
- Set PTAs
- Make sure drivers are current on preventative maintenance on their trucks
- Covering all freight, including overbooked and current freight.
- Update drivers on road conditions and restrictions as advised by the Safety Department.
- Approving timecards on a weekly basis, including PTO request.
- Handling driver complaints, escalating the issues to the appropriate party when necessary.
- Assigning new drivers to DMs accordingly.
- Ensuring the of speed of trust behaviors are upheld by every member of the team to promote a collaborating, productive and professional work environment.
- Other duties may be assigned based off business needs.

Transco Lines operates over 350 power units and 700 dry van trailers. Our fleet consists of 175 solo drivers and 170 teams. Our niche in the marketplace is customized service for customers requiring Just-In-Time performance. We pride ourselves on providing ultra-modern assets for our drivers and superior service to our customers.
